Former Liverpool striker Peter Crouch believes that manager Arne Slot's job is safe, regardless of the outcome of this season.
Despite Liverpool's recent poor performance, having lost six of their past seven games, Crouch thinks that Slot's success last season has earned him enough credit to secure his position.
He's earned enough grace from last season to certainly see this season through.
Crouch does acknowledge concerns over Slot's selection and tactics, particularly in the Carabao Cup, where he made several changes to the team.
